Лекции по дисциплине



бет4/23
Дата06.01.2022
өлшемі1,77 Mb.
#14617
түріКонспект
1   2   3   4   5   6   7   8   9   ...   23
Байланысты:
konspekt lekciy mdk 01 03

2.2. Структура конфигурации

Конфигурация, являющаяся составной частью системы программ «1С: Предприятие», с точки зрения пользователя является собственно «программой». В конфигурации в целом объединены данные и метаданные.

Программист, использующий среду разработки Конфигуратор, работает с конфигурацией, как главным объектом процесса разработки. С точки зрения программиста конфигурация – это проект, объединяющий в своем составе модель предметной области и программный код.

В целом можно представить упрощенную схему процесса разработки, когда конфигурация как проект разработки превращается в типовую конфигурацию, с которой работают пользователи (рис.2.2).



Рис. 2.2. К понятию «конфигурация»
В «1С: Предприятии» данные и метаданные хранятся в одном месте, которое называется информационной базой (рис.2.3).

Информационная база – совокупность данных и метаданных, хранящихся в локальной или серверной базе данных и доступных для пользователей и разработчиков

При работе с базой данных пользователей редактируемые данные блокируются. Это относится как к данным, так и метаданным. Действительно, нельзя изменить структуру таблицы, если ее содержимое заблокировано хотя бы и частично. Для того, чтобы обеспечить возможность разработки (доработки) конфигурации одновременно с работой пользователей, в «1С: Предприятии» используются два экземпляра конфигурации.



Рис. 2.3. Процесс обновления информационной базы
Конфигурация БД – метаданные, содержащие структуру конфигурации, хранящиеся в локальной или серверной БД, недоступные для интерактивного изменения.

Основная конфигурация - метаданные, содержащие структуру конфигурации, хранящиеся в локальной или серверной БД, доступные для интерактивного изменения.

Разработчик в процессе работы имеет дело с основной конфигурацией. Ее состав доступен в дереве конфигурации в среде разработки Конфигуратор. После внесения необходимых изменений (в ходе этих работ пользователи продолжают работать с информационной базой) разработчик обновляет конфигурацию базы данных и на этом этапе необходимо использовать информационную базу в монопольном режиме.

Конфигурация имеет в своем составе:


  • Структуру учетных данных (основные объекты – справочники, документы, планы);

  • Структуру пользовательского интерфейса (формы, меню, командные панели и т.д.);

  • Модули различных типов с программным кодом (общие, объектов, форм);

  • Механизмы хранения и обработки итоговых данных (регистры);

  • Механизмы представления бизнес-процессов (бизнес-процессы и задачи);

  • Механизмы создания распределенных информационных баз (планы обмена);

  • Механизмы разграничения прав доступа;

  • Вспомогательные объекты



Достарыңызбен бөлісу:
1   2   3   4   5   6   7   8   9   ...   23




©emirsaba.org 2024
әкімшілігінің қараңыз

    Басты бет